i try to migrate my JBoss 4.2.2 Application (and an Eclipse based remote client) to JBoss 5.0.0.
I am getting some exceptions during remote calls of SLSBs and SFSBs on my client.

The context creation and lookup has been performed correctly. As I see in the server log, the SFSB has been created.
Calling method sendTextMessage of a SLSB causes:

java.lang.NullPointerException

Calling method retrieve of SFSB causes:

java.lang.ClassCastException: org.jboss.aop.joinpoint.MethodInvocation cannot be cast to org.jboss.ejb3.stateful.StatefulRemoteInvocation

Could that be a Class-Path problem? jbossall-client.jar and all it's dependencies are available...
Client and server are running on JDK 1.5.0.
